ChocolateDipped Spumoni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 cup butter, softened
3/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
2 eggs
1 T vanilla extract
2½ c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up Dutch-processed cocoa
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
1⅓ cups finely chopped pistachios, divided
1⅓ cups finely chopped dried cherries, divided
1¾ cups semisweet chocolate chips
1 T shortening.

Directions:
Directions:
Preheat oven to 350º.
In a large bowl, c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y.
Beat in eggs and vanilla.
In another bowl, whisk flour, cocoa, baking soda and salt; gradually beat into creamed mixture.
Stir in 1 cup each pistachios and cherries.
Drop by tablespoonfuls 2 inches apart onto ungreased baking sheets.
Bake 10-12 minutes or until set. Cool on pans 2 minutes.
Remove to wire racks to cool.
In a microwave, melt chocolate chips and shortening; stir until smooth.
Dip each cookie halfway into chocolate;allowing excess to drip off; sprinkle with remaining pistachios and cherries.
Place on waxed paper; let stand until set.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
6 dozen cookies
